England's Euro 2020 Fixtures, Dates And Route To The Final

 

England's Euro 2020 Fixtures

England will face both Ukraine or Sweden in the quarter-finals of Euro 2020 if they can overcome Germany in their last-16 tie on Tuesday June 29.


With England having won Group D, they will now face the runners-up in Group F, Germany, at Wembley on Tuesday June 29 at 5pm.


But whilst the 'risk' of topping Group D was, from the outset, that England were likely to face a powerhouse opponent in the last-16, the longer-term benefit of progressing as winners is that England - and Germany! - are now in the different half of the draw to France, Italy, Spain, Belgium and Portugal.


It means that, were they to overcome Germany on Tuesday, England's quarter-final opponents will be either Sweden or Ukraine subsequent Saturday in Rome.


Looking further ahead, England's semi-final opponents, were they to attain the last four, would be either Netherlands, Czech Republic, Wales or Denmark.
